What are my cheap ticket options for Digby & Sowton to Chorley journeys?

From booking in Advance, to our FairSplits, here are our tips for you to find the best price

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Digby & Sowton to Chorley start from as little as £31.10

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Digby & Sowton to Chorley start from £87.90 one way, or £175.80 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Digby & Sowton to Chorley are available for £155.70 one way, or £311.10 return

Everything you need to know about Digby & Sowton Station

Discovering Digby & Sowton Train Station: A Hidden Gem in Southwest England

Located on the edge of the historic city of Exeter, Digby & Sowton train station serves as a convenient gateway for both commuters and explorers venturing into one of the UK's most picturesque regions. Though it may not boast the grandeur of larger stations, Digby & Sowton offers a blend of essential amenities and excellent transport links that make it a practical choice for many travelers.

Station Facilities and Amenities

While Digby & Sowton station may not have a ticket office, it provides easy access to ticket machines for quick pass retrieval. The station supports accessibility with step-free access throughout. For those requiring assistance, a help point is available, and customer support can be reached through GWR’s online services or social media. Additionally, the station features CCTV for enhanced security.

Among the features that cater to passenger convenience, there is a free car park with 21 spaces open 24 hours a day. Cyclists can make use of 20 bike storage spots, although shelter is not available. However, if you’re looking for a bite or a caffeine fix, you might need to plan ahead as there are no refreshment facilities or shops on the premises, nor are there ATMs available.

Accessibility and Support

Digby & Sowton ensures smooth transit for passengers with reduced mobility. Ramps make for straightforward platform access, although there are no staff-assisted services on-site—help can be arranged in advance through Passenger Assist. The lack of waiting rooms and accessible toilets may be a drawback for some, but seating is available.

Travel Connections and Beyond

One of the advantages of this station is its integration with local transport. There's a bus service that connects directly through the station forecourt. You can download more detailed travel plans from here for your convenience.

For those concerned about rail disruptions, the station provides a rail replacement service, ensuring continuity in travel plans through its location over the station footbridge.

Everything you need to know about Chorley Station

Exploring Chorley Train Station

Located in the heart of the picturesque Lancashire town, Chorley Train Station serves as a pivotal hub for commuters and travelers looking to explore the north-west of England. The station blends functionality with accessibility, providing various amenities to enhance your travel experience. Whether you're embarking on your daily commute, exploring new destinations, or simply seeking a leisurely journey, Chorley Station caters to all your travel needs.

Facilities and Accessibility at Chorley Station

Chorley Station ensures a seamless ticketing experience with its easily accessible ticket office and machines. The ticket office operates from 06:25 to early evenings on weekdays and extends later into the evening on Saturdays, ensuring ample time for ticket purchases. For those who prefer digital convenience, smartcards are issued at the station, accompanied by validators for a swift and hassle-free check-in.

Your safety and comfort are paramount, with the station being equipped with CCTV. Although there are no waiting areas or first-class lounges, seating is available for your convenience. It's worth noting that while the station is fully equipped with steps and ramps for step-free access, it does fall short in terms of some accessible facilities such as accessible toilets and waiting rooms.

Transport Links and Connectivity

Chorley Station is fantastically connected to various transport modes. If your journey involves buses, the nearby bus interchange on Shepherd’s Way caters to connections for routes towards Bolton and Preston. Additionally, for those looking to conveniently book a cab, resources such as the [Cab4You service](https://www.northernrailway.co.uk/tickets/cab4you) offer easy online taxi reservations.

Although bicycle hire isn't available directly at the station, the local vicinity provides opportunities for cycling enthusiasts to explore further.
